Turkey Issues Final Call to Iraqi Kurds to Cancel Independence Vote
Turkey’s government will never accept a separate Kurdish state in neighboring Iraq and won’t refrain from taking steps to prevent it, Turkish Prime Minister Binali Yildirim said Friday.
